Elizabeth Jane Hurley (born 10 June 1965) is an English actress and model.
As an actress, her best-known film roles have been as Vanessa Kensington in Austin Powers: International Man of Mystery (1997) and as the Devil in Bedazzled (2000). Hurley’s television roles include the E! original series The Royals (2015–2018) and portraying Morgan le Fay in Runaways (2019), based on the Marvel Comics series of the same name.
She has been associated with the cosmetics company Estée Lauder since the company gave Hurley her first modelling job at the age of 29.They have featured her as a representative and model for their products, especially perfumes such as Sensuous, Intuition, and Pleasures, since 1995.
